TORONTO — Canadian rapper Drake announced Thursday he is unable to perform July 5 at the Wireless festival in the UK.
“To my beloved fans, it truly breaks my heart that I won’t be able to perform as planned at Wireless and Roskilde this weekend,” Drake, 27, said in a statement to fans posted on the festival website.
“I got sick a few days ago and although I am on my way to bouncing back, my doctors have made it clear that I am not physically fit to fly or deliver the performance my fans expect and deserve from me.”
The Toronto-born rap star, who did not attend the BET Awards last week, did not divulge the nature of his illness.
“I will be focused on resting for a quick recovery,” said Drake.
Festival organizers said Kanye West will fill in for Drake for one performance.
